Okay, the situation is like this...

I forgot to put password on my computer in hostel and now I'm away for a few weeks, somebody turned on my computer and my msn automatically connected while i'm at home get disconnected, this happened a few times and i feel that its very annoying.

I got webcam there attached with my computer, can i remote connect to my computer at hostel there to control my webcam and see who's using my computer?

RealVNC should work fine. http://www.realvnc.com

1st things 1st.. i'm very sure that your pc at the hostel is running behind a NAT, so you have to ask the network admin to forward a port for you at the router so that you can remotely access with whatever software that you use. Other than that, sorry lah laugh.gif
